Trayce Jackson-Davis wins Karl Malone Power Forward of the Year Award
Indiana men’s basketball senior forward Trayce Jackson-Davis was awarded the Karl Malone Power Forward of the Year award, the Basketball Hall of Fame announced Saturday.

No. 19 Indiana men’s basketball entered its Big Ten Tournament semifinal matchup against Penn State eager to avenge an ugly 85-66 loss from Jan. 11 in State College, Pennsylvania. The Hoosiers weren’t able to do so despite a major comeback bid throughout the second half and fell 77-73 to the Nittany Lions.

Indiana men’s basketball fifth-year senior point guard Xavier Johnson will not return for the remainder of the season, IU Athletics announced Saturday afternoon. Johnson suffered a broken foot against the University of Kansas on Dec. 17 and has not played since exiting the game.

No. 17 Indiana men’s basketball entered Saturday’s contest at No. 5 Purdue in hopes of completing a regular season sweep of its in-state rival. The Hoosiers ultimately defeated the Boilermakers 79-71 despite a cold offensive showing from its star player.
